The Santa Ana Police Department is currently investigating a disturbing incident captured on video and circulating on social media. The footage shows a victim being assaulted and stabbed by three suspects in broad daylight.
On Tuesday, August 6, 2024, at around 12 p.m., officers responded to a call regarding an assault with a deadly weapon in the area of McFadden Avenue and S. Sullivan Street. Upon arrival, they found the victim lying on the sidewalk with multiple stab wounds to his abdomen.
The investigation revealed that the victim was involved in a dispute with the suspects at a public park. During the altercation, all three suspects, armed with knives, attacked and stabbed the victim multiple times in the area of Diamond Street and Fairview Street, just northwest of Jerome Park.
Thankfully, the victim is expected to survive. The Santa Ana Police Department is urging anyone with information on the whereabouts of the suspects to contact Detective G. Corona at (714) 245-8429 or email GCorona@santa-ana.org.
